Feldspar is the name given to a group of minerals distinguished by the presence of alumina and silica (SiO2) in their chemistry. This group includes aluminum silicates of soda, potassium, or lime. It is the single most abundant mineral group on Earth. They account for an estimated 60% of exposed rocks, as well as soils, clays, and other unconsolidated sediments, and are principal components in rock classification schemes. The minerals included in this group are the orthoclase, microcline and plagioclase feldspars.

Process of Barytes Industrial processing methods depend on the final use and application of Barytes i.e. drilling grades may only require crushing, grinding, screening and milling, whereas higher purity and lower particle size Barytes products require floatation, bleaching and wet grinding.

We are prominent provider of Laterite Lumps that are soil types rich in iron and aluminum, formed in hot and wet tropical areas. Nearly all laterites are rusty-red because of iron oxides. These Laterite Lumps are developed by intensive and long-lasting weathering of the underlying parent rock. Clients can avail Laterite Lumps from us in the require amount with assured purity.
Laterites are a source of aluminum ore. The ore exists largely in clay minerals and thehydroxides, gibbsite, boehmite, and diaspore, which resembles the composition of bauxite. Laterite ores also were the early major source of nickel.

The commercial Feldspar is potash Feldspar. The potassium molecule is replaced by sodium to some extent and hence, potash Feldspar usually contains a small percentage of sodium. The composition range of the commercial Feldspar varies within the limits of potash, soda and silica.
Potash and soda Feldspar occur as essential constituents of granite, syenite and gneisses. However, workable deposits are found in pegmatite veins consisting mainly of Feldspar, Quartz-Feldspar veins and also occur with mica pegmatites.

Laterite stone have traditionally used after directly extraction from the naturally occurring laterite sources, after which they are cut into brick-like shapes for use as walling units. Recently, there has been advancement in using laterite in the form of interlocking bricks used to construct walls without the use of cement mortar. Laterite stone is ground and filtered using a sieve, which is then mixed with 5% cement mixture and a chemical setting agent. This mixture is then machine compressed to form high density interlocking bricks. They are manufactured in two widths of 6 inches and 8 inches; and are also available in varying lengths. Each interlocking brick has grooves and locks on its sides which can be fitted with each other to form a block wall that does not need cement mortar for bonding. They have lower embodied energy due to use of natural locally available materials- stone and wood. The only energy spent is in transportation of materials. The high recycle ability factor especially in case of interlocking blocks which dont use connecting mortar is a bonus.
